The South Florida Bull’s disheveled start to the Skip Holtz era took another lump from the struggling Syracuse Orangemen this past Saturday. South Florida dropped to 3-2 due to the home loss by a final score of 13-9 (Yuck! No good can come from a score like that). Offense has been a bit evanescent for the Bulls with turnovers being the main culprit for their severe lack of any consistency.
